The Opportunity:


The TMCoE is looking for an eLearning Specialist to join the team and work with Subject Matter Experts (SMEs) and stakeholders to design, develop and deploy e-learning content for the University's employee-centric learning management system under the general direction of the Manager, Talent Development.

You will work to set quality assurance standards, maintain e-learning solutions, and evaluate the effectiveness of programs; ensure that e-learning programs reflect best practices in instructional and user experience design; and be responsible for storyboarding, authoring, and developing e-learning content and blended learning solutions

Other responsibilities include:

  • Performs essential research and development activities to support the learning and development strategy.
  • Leads eLearning projects using an agile instructional design approach to ensure course design, activities, assessments, and resources are aligned with desired learning outcomes and quality standards.
  • Contributes to the development of communications and change management strategies related to eLearning implementations and works with Senior Consultants to implement related project plans.
  • Works collaboratively with TMCoE staff and vendors on complex learning projects, leveraging artificial intelligence (AI), gamification, virtual reality (VR), and other emerging technologies for learning, and advises on best practices for Learning Management System (LMS) use.
  • Acts as an internal instructional design consultant to facilitate the creation of learning experiences that prioritize equity, diversity, inclusion, and pedagogical excellence for adult learning in the digital learning space.
  • In collaboration with the HR Communications teams, oversees the integration of multimedia content (such as videos, animations, and interactive modules) to ensure compatibility and optimal performance within the LMS environment.
  • Continuously updates and improves content based on feedback and evolving standards, engaging internal and external user groups to ensure learning outcomes, needs, and expectations are met.

Qualifications
To help us learn more about you, please provide a cover letter and resume describing how you meet the following required qualifications:

  • Post-secondary degree required in Business Administration/Information Technology, Educational Technologies, Education, Distance/Online education, Instructional Design or related program or; Post-graduate certificate in E-Learning or working equivalency is required.
  • Certifications in, or experience with, instructional design and eLearning development tools including Articulate Storyline, Adobe Captivate, or related authoring tools that support SCORM.
  • Minimum three to five (35) years experience in developing eLearning content, instructional design, and digital media production.
  • Working experience with Learning Management Systems (LMS).
  • Experience with adapting and implementing current and emerging eLearning technologies, practices, and pedagogy, with a strong understanding of how to effectively engage and educate adult learners in a digital environment.
  • Experience in managing multistakeholder projects and successful vendor management to deliver programs and learning initiatives in a complex environment.
  • Proficient in developing content using universal design principles to create inclusive learning experiences that comply with accessibility standards such as AODA and WCAG.
  • Superior project management skills and strong organizational skills to ensure quality and timeliness of work.
  • Technical writing skills to explain the use of complex business systems; ability to develop/use style guides.
  • Excellent interpersonal, conflict management skills, and facilitation skills with the ability to work with colleagues at different levels in the organization.
